Welcome to the TideGlass widget team. The widget renders tide tables for the Brinmouth harbor app using predictions from our internal Swellcast service. Data refreshes every six hours; the cron config lives in ops/tideglass.yml. Most maintenance involves updating station offsets when Swellcast changes its schema. Builds are produced by the Lanternworks CI pool and must be signed before the harbor kiosks will accept them. The signing key used by the pipeline is shown below.

signing key of fajop-tahop = bky9_qdL6xeDv7

## Runbook: Pixelpond Image Cache Leak

If memory on a render node climbs past 85%, it's almost always the thumbnail cache not evicting. Quick fix: restart the cache worker; it drains cleanly. Log the incident so we can track frequency. Eviction stats and incident entries go in the ops database, reachable via the connection string below.

replica DSN, kajep-yahag: mssql://praok_svc:iF@db-8d68.plorvaio.local:5432/eliion

**Release checklist — TideScope widget (v2.4)**

Verify the tide-table widget renders correctly for harbors with mixed semidiurnal patterns; Port Marlewick is the canonical test case. Confirm the offline cache falls back to the last synced table rather than showing empty rows. Localization strings for the Brinley coast region shipped late, so double-check the height-unit toggle. QA signed off Tuesday; Dara owns the final smoke test. The candidate build for this release is listed below.

pipeline stamp: htk21_104c5ba7d0df6b2897cd5

## Configuration

Gridfall's spreadsheet export streams rows by default; set EXPORT_BUFFER_ROWS to cap in-memory batching (default 5000). Raising it past 20000 risks OOM on standard release pods — do not ship a higher value without a heap profile attached to the release ticket. Exports to the archive bucket are encrypted at rest, and the exporter signs each upload with a key read from the env file, set on the line that follows.

env line for fafof-fahag: LEDGER_TOKEN5=f8790

☐ **Nightly Backfill Scheduler — cutover check.** Confirm the Grayvale scheduler completed its dry-run against the Mossbank replica before promoting. On-call: if any partition shows a retry count above three, halt the rollout and page data-platform. After a clean dry-run, verify the running build matches the token below.

pipeline stamp: htk6_35e0c9